Abstract:
A vehicle power supply apparatus includes first and second power supply systems, an electrical conduction path, a switch, and a switch controller. The first power supply system includes a first electrical energy accumulator and an electric load. The second power supply system includes a generator and a second electrical energy accumulator. The switch is configured to be controlled to a turn-on state and a turn-off state. The turn-on state includes coupling the electric load and the second electrical energy accumulator to each other, and the turn-off state includes isolating them from each other. The switch controller controls the switch to the turn-on state on the condition that the generator has an abnormality, and afterwards controls the switch to the turn-off state.
